During the period of May 27-31, 2025, the State Agency for Metrological and Technical Supervision (DAMTN) carried out a campaign inspection of various types of children's toys offered on the market throughout the country. Inspectors from the General Directorate "Market Surveillance" at DAMTN inspected products intended for play or other purposes for children under the age of 14.
A total of 237 types of toys were inspected, and it was found that 99 of them met the requirements. However, for 138 (58%) of the inspected products, discrepancies were found. Among them, 62 types did not have the mandatory "CE" conformity marking, 105 types did not contain the name and address of the manufacturer and importer, 62 types lacked instructions for use and safety information in Bulgarian, 62 types were not equipped with warning texts, and 10 types had other discrepancies, including the lack of mandatory information on maintaining hygiene for toys for children under 36 months.
The campaign conducted in 2025 shows better results compared to 2024, when non-compliant products were 66% of those inspected. The reduction in the share of low-quality toys is due to the increased consumer culture and awareness of parents, as well as the increased responsibility of economic operators offering these goods on the market.
Administrative and penal measures have been taken against the responsible persons for the established violations, and orders have been issued to stop the distribution of products without the "CE" marking. DAMTN will continue to carry out inspections to prevent the offering of children's toys that do not comply with the requirements.
